In-Depth Overview of the Honda S660

Categorized under Japan’s Kei car segment, the Honda S660 epitomizes the ingenuity required to maximize performance within stringent dimensional and engine displacement restrictions. Kei cars benefit from significant tax and insurance advantages in Japan, fostering widespread adoption. Despite these limitations, the S660’s lightweight architecture and mid-engine, rear-wheel-drive (MR) configuration deliver a dynamic driving experience, reminiscent of classic sports cars, yet redefined for modern urban environments.

Design Philosophy and Exterior Architecture

The aesthetic and functional design of the Honda S660 is a study in aerodynamic efficiency and contemporary styling. Its compact form factor—measuring 3,395 mm in length, 1,475 mm in width, and 1,180 mm in height—enhances maneuverability in dense urban settings while maintaining an aggressive stance characteristic of performance vehicles.

  • Front Fascia: The angular LED headlamps and bold front grille are not merely stylistic choices but are optimized for aerodynamic efficiency, reducing drag coefficients and enhancing cooling efficiency.
  • Lateral Profile: The pronounced wheel arches and streamlined body panels are complemented by precision-engineered alloy wheels, contributing to both aesthetics and structural rigidity. Short overhangs and a broad track width improve lateral stability and cornering dynamics.
  • Rear Configuration: The rear design integrates functional elements such as a centrally mounted exhaust system and an aerodynamic diffuser, optimizing airflow management. The integrated rear spoiler is not just decorative; it provides measurable downforce at higher velocities, enhancing traction.
  • Convertible Mechanism: The manual soft-top roof underscores the S660’s driver-centric ethos, facilitating an immersive open-air driving experience without the weight penalty of automated mechanisms.

Powertrain and Dynamic Performance

At the heart of the Honda S660 lies a turbocharged 660cc three-cylinder DOHC engine, calibrated to deliver approximately 64 horsepower. While modest in absolute terms, this output is augmented by the vehicle’s sub-850 kg curb weight, resulting in an impressive power-to-weight ratio within its class.

  • Engine Characteristics: The forced induction system enhances low-end torque delivery, ensuring responsive throttle dynamics. The engine’s high-revving nature caters to enthusiasts seeking an engaging driving experience.
  • Transmission Options: Enthusiasts can choose between a 6-speed manual transmission, offering precise gear engagement and mechanical feedback, or a continuously variable transmission (CVT) optimized for urban efficiency.
  • Chassis and Handling: The MR layout, coupled with a meticulously tuned suspension system, affords exceptional handling precision. The double-wishbone suspension at both front and rear ensures optimal camber control, enhancing grip during high-speed cornering.
  • Braking Systems: High-performance disc brakes, featuring ventilated front rotors and solid rear discs, are augmented by electronic brakeforce distribution (EBD) and anti-lock braking systems (ABS), ensuring consistent deceleration under varied conditions.

Fuel Efficiency Metrics

The S660’s engineering extends beyond performance to include remarkable fuel efficiency, a hallmark of kei car design. Its aerodynamic profile, lightweight construction, and efficient powertrain collaborate to minimize fuel consumption.

  • Consumption Rates: The vehicle achieves an average fuel economy of approximately 20 km/l, with potential for higher efficiency under optimal driving conditions.
  • Eco-Technological Enhancements: Advanced models incorporate eco-driving assist technologies, adjusting throttle response and ancillary load management to optimize fuel utilization.
  • Cost-Efficiency: In addition to fuel savings, owners benefit from reduced operational costs due to lower taxation and insurance premiums associated with kei car classification.

Safety Architecture

Honda’s commitment to safety is evident in the S660’s comprehensive suite of protective features, despite its compact dimensions. The vehicle integrates both passive and active safety systems to safeguard occupants.

  • Airbag Deployment: Dual-stage front airbags and optional side-impact airbags provide extensive coverage in collision scenarios.
  • Advanced Braking Technologies: The inclusion of ABS with EBD enhances braking stability, while Vehicle Stability Assist (VSA) mitigates oversteer and understeer tendencies.
  • Structural Integrity: The use of ultra-high-strength steel in critical load paths improves crash energy dissipation, maintaining occupant compartment integrity.
  • Driver Assistance Features: Depending on the trim, features such as rearview cameras and proximity sensors aid in maneuverability and collision avoidance in urban settings.

Global Market Presence and Import Considerations

While the S660 was designed primarily for the Japanese domestic market (JDM), its cult status has spurred international interest, particularly among automotive enthusiasts and collectors.

  • Import Dynamics: Prospective buyers must navigate complex import regulations, including compliance with emissions standards and right-hand-drive considerations in certain markets.
  • International Enthusiast Communities: The S660 boasts a vibrant global following, with active online forums, owner clubs, and events dedicated to this distinctive model.
